大家好,今天小编关注到一个有意思的话题,就是关于c语言 参数 数组的问题,于是小编就整理了4个相关介绍c语言 参数 数组的解答,让我们一起看看吧。
c语言有数组?
我们常见的C需要类型数组有:
int:是整型变量,输入整数,范围不大,在-32767到32767,
float:输入可以使小数也可以输入整数,在不确定的情况下,就用float,范围还是比较的大,
大家好,今天小编关注到一个有意思的话题,就是关于c语言 参数 数组的问题,于是小编就整理了4个相关介绍c语言 参数 数组的解答,让我们一起看看吧。
我们常见的C需要类型数组有:
int:是整型变量,输入整数,范围不大,在-32767到32767,
float:输入可以使小数也可以输入整数,在不确定的情况下,就用float,范围还是比较的大,
double:如果说float是四个字节的话,大伯是八个字节。范围比float大好多。
C语言是一门通用计算机编程语言,应用广泛。C语言的设计目标是提供一种能以简易的方式编译、处理低级存储器、产生少量的机器码以及不需要任何运行环境支持便能运行的编程语言。 尽管C语言提供了许多低级处理的功能,但仍然保持着良好跨平台的特性。
以一个标准规格写出的C语言程序可在许多电脑平台上进行编译,甚至包含一些嵌入式处理器(单片机或称MCU)以及超级电脑等作业平台。 二十世纪八十年代,为了避免各开发厂商用的C语言语法产生差异,由美国国家标准局为C语言制定了一套完整的美国国家标准语法,称为ANSI C,作为C语言最初的标准。
我们常见的C需要类型数组有:
char:只允许输入字符,int:是整型变量,输入整数,范围不大,在-32767到32767,float:输入可以使小数也可以输入整数,在不确定的情况下,就用float,范围还是比较的大,double:如果说float是四个字节的话,大伯是八个字节。范围比float大好多。C语言是一门通用计算机编程语言,应用广泛。C语言的设计目标是提供一种能以简易的方式编译、处理低级存储器、产生少量的机器码以及不需要任何运行环境支持便能运行的编程语言。
c语言函数的参数值除了可以用数组元素作为函数参数外,还可以用数组名作函数参数。
用数组元素作实参时,向形参变量传递的是数组元素的值,而用数组名作函数实参时,向形参传递的是数组首元素的地址。
C语言用数组名作函数参数,应该在主调函数和被调函数分别定义数组。
实参数组与形参数组类型应一致,如不一致,结构出错。
形参数组可以不指定大小,在定义数组时在数组名后面跟一个指针变量,用来接收一个地址。
默认值是不可意料的。 不同编译器对静态常量的处理方法可能不一致,但多数编译器翻译会汇编语言都是用的db 0这种方式,那么默认值为0,但是我们不要依赖这个,因为C语言标准没有规定一定要这么做,程序中也可以用db ?方式实现。 对于局部变量,几乎所有的编译器都是利用add bp,n之后,用[bp+n]来表示,它的值是完全不可医疗的。
到此,以上就是小编对于c语言 参数 数组的问题就介绍到这了,希望介绍关于c语言 参数 数组的4点解答对大家有用。